Is 32P option in the treatment of bone metastases pain?

This paper deals with the international experience of using sodium orthophosphate labeled with 32P as a first radiopharmaceutical for the treatment of metastatic bone disease (EOM). It examines the decline in use when introducing other products considered best features is exposed and its rebirth from the comparable efficacy, possibility for oral use, lower cost and absence of incontrovertible evidence about their side effects inadmissible. It is also aware of the user experience in Cuba and concludes that the radiopharmaceutical should be part of the arsenal of resources to be used in the EOM, given the prevalence of this and the economic burden of handling. Non-clinical and clinical data on promissory features of 90Y-EDTMP are also discussed. (author)
